Airplanes from the movie: Tiger Moth and Stearman Tiger Moth D.H.82A and Stearman (Boeing) Model 75 aircraft were single-engined
biplanes that had good flight technical qualities combined with relatively simple
construction Produced in large quantities (Tiger Moth D.H.82A - about 8,000 examples, Stearman (Boeing) Model 75 - about 10,000), they used
very popular, they could be seen in different regions of the globe -
from North America to the Far East. A certain number of Tiger Moth D.H.82A
and the Stearman Model 75 continue to fly and now, these are the planes that have survived
private individuals or in aero clubs. They also met in works of art and
movies, in particular, they became prototypes of airplanes from the famous movie
"The English Patient". Flight scenes against the background of the Sahara desert in North Africa
remembered by many for their expressiveness, Tiger Moth D.H.82A and Stearman Model 75
did a great job with their role. The award-winning film allows
enjoy the episodes with these simple and perfect airplanes.
